Matthew Granger is a scholar working on Physiology, Molecular Biology and Behavioral Neuroscience. According to data from OpenAlex, Matthew Granger has authored 5 papers receiving a total of 75 indexed citations (citations by other indexed papers that have themselves been cited), including 3 papers in Physiology, 2 papers in Molecular Biology and 1 paper in Behavioral Neuroscience. Recurrent topics in Matthew Granger's work include Alzheimer's disease research and treatments (3 papers), Metabolomics and Mass Spectrometry Studies (2 papers) and Stress Responses and Cortisol (1 paper). Matthew Granger is often cited by papers focused on Alzheimer's disease research and treatments (3 papers), Metabolomics and Mass Spectrometry Studies (2 papers) and Stress Responses and Cortisol (1 paper). Matthew Granger collaborates with scholars based in Canada, China and United Kingdom. Matthew Granger's co-authors include Steffany A. L. Bennett, Peter St George‐Hyslop, Claude Messier, Alexandre P. Blanchard, Fred Elisma, Hongbin Xu, Hui Liu, Fangjun Wang, Daniel Figeys and Weidong Le and has published in prestigious journals such as Journal of Neurochemistry, Journal of Alzheimer s Disease and PROTEOMICS.
